Arshiyaa Taj Khan, also known as Meraaqi, is a poetess based in Mumbai, India. Inspired by the immortality of words, she started writing at the age of fourteen. Divine Trouble is her debut poetry book and she intends to write many, many more. Read More...

Divine Trouble is a journey that begins with fear and ends in the pursuit of trouble. The book breathes poetry inspired by nine universal emotions. It is a poetic tryst with much of what is often unacknowledged within the colossal depth of the human soul.
It is a lament, a love affair, a celebration and
an ecstatic torment.
